汽车销售管理信息系统的系统规划一、汽车销售管理信息系统的系统规划第一节项目开发背景随着经济的发展和中国汽车市场的不断扩大,某汽车配件公司也随着发展的浪潮不断扩大规模,随之,订单成倍增加,各项业务更加细化,各部门工作量增加,以往的人工处理方式就显得力不从心,劳动强度大而且容易出错。项目开发目的本课程设计的具体任务就是设计一个企业内部业务管理信息系统,利用现代计算机和数据库开发技术来代替人工处理,从而减轻企业各部门工作人员的劳动强度,提高工作质量和效率,提高信息资源的利用率和企业管理水平。可行性分析现在企业的业务流程管理方式为手工处理,重复劳动多,劳动强度大,而且容易出错,新系统的使用将有以下几个方面的优势:从技术上考察A.处理速度快,准确;B.通过权限的设置,数据的安全性好;C.方便查询;D.控制精度或生产能力的提高2.从经济上考察A.系统建设不需要很大的投入;B.可缩减人员编制,减少人力费用;C.人员利用率的改进;3.从各种社会因素来考察A.可降低工作人员工作强度,提高效率,会得到企业上下员工的一致同意的;B.可引进先进的管理系统开发方案,从而达到充分利用企业现有资源综上所述,本系统的开发立项是可行的。第二章企业内部业务管理信息系统的系统分析第一节组织结构与功能分析图1组织结构图第二节组织/业务关系图联系组织程度销售部会计部采购部仓库经理销售活动*财务管理*采购活动*库存管理*行政监督管理*图2组织/业务关系图业务第三节业务功能一览表图3业务功能一览表第四节业务流程图经营主管销售主管仓库主管采购主管财务主管业务员仓库采购员财务会计销售员管理应收款明细账管理应付款账目管理会计总账编制报表收款发出订货单验收货物入库接收发货单修改库存量管理货物入库出库检索库存验证订货单修改订货单开发货单检查暂存订货单确定顾客订货图4业务流程图第五节数据流程图销售历史公司档案存档会计人员暂定订单核对验收入库检查暂存订货单应收款明细账核对应收款明细账采购人员供应商经理订货配件汇总订货单填写发货单发货单修改会计总账会计总账应付款账目接受并开收据修改应收款明细账编制报表查询库存量顾客销售部门订货单库存配件发货单验证订货单确定顾客订货检索库存开发货单并修改库存产生暂定订单登录新客户数据客户数据到货通知修改库存量付款业务员收据纠正错误不合格订单发订单合格订单不满足订货检索满足订货有新顾客修改开发货单通知记录记录图5-1销售过程数据流图1.1.5登录新顾客数据采购人员业务人员1.1.1验证订货单1.1.4产生暂定订单1.1.2确定顾客订货1.1.3开发货单修改库存暂定订单应收款明细账库存配件顾客数据销售历史顾客确定给采购人员发货单发出到货通知记录对照暂存订单记录产生开出发货图5-2采购过程数据流图供货商销售部门采购人员1.1.1订货配件汇总订货单1.1.2订货1.1.3填写发货单发货单1.1.4核对验收入库1.1.6办理销售业务发货单到货通知库存配件应收款明细账1.1.5通知销售部门顾客给顾客收据开出现金支票转账无误给会计发货单无误修改提供依据提供依据提交编制提交编制提交编制图5-3财务过程数据流图应付款账目1.1.5修改会计总账1.1.1付款顾客1.1.2核对应收款明细账1.1.3接受并开收据收据1.1.4修改应收款明细账应收款明细账会计人员供应商1.1.6核对应付款账目1.1.7付款并修改应付款账目会计总账1.1.8编制报表会计报表销售分析报表库存报表经理库存配件1.1.9查询库存量第六节系统数据库建模----E-R模型分析1N1N1N111111N11111NN1NNN11NN1NNMMNN11N图6-1E-R图销售顾客配件采购部门供销商经理销售部门库存配件会计部门应付款账目应收款明细账报表客户订单公司合作合作编辑接受属于查询记录属于管理参考对应产生对应管理产生属于购买供应图6-2E-R图第七节系统U/C矩阵分析图7U/C矩阵第三章汽车销售管理信息系统的系统设计顾客数据发货单应收款账目销售历史暂存订单公司订单到货通知应付款账目收付单据会计总账报表库存销售管理客户管理CU销售配件UCUUU记录业务CC采购管理记录缺货UCU追加订货UC验货入库UUCCU财务管理收付款UUUUC会计核算UUUCU编制报表UUUUUCU库存管理库存管理UUUC监督管理UUUUU数据类功能第一节功能子系统划分根据U/C矩阵分析,对汽车配件公司业务管理信息系统进行功能子系统划分,如图8所示。本系统只要花分为四个功能子系统:图8系统功能子系统图销售管理子系统:对客户数据、订货处理等销售业务进行管理;财务管理子系统:负责各种报表和账目的管理工作;采购管理子系统:管理供应商信息,进行采购、收货、验货等采购业务;库存管理子系统:对仓库存货进行管理和监督。第二节层次化模块结构图企业业务管理系统库存管理财务管理采购管理销售管理会计账目管理会计报表管理订货管理客户管理采购配件管理供应商管理库存量管理库存查询管理汽车配件公司业务管理信息系统中,模块划分和处理过程设计是非常关键的一步,因此,我本着对系统可修改性、易读性、易查错性等方面进行设计。基本思想是:1、模块化;2、图表文字解说。其中,HIPO图是一种强有力的描述系统机构和模块内部处理功能的工具,它主要包括层次结构图和IPO图两个部分。层次结构图描述了整个系统的设计结构以及各类模块之间的关系;IPO图则描述了在某个特定模块内部的输入(I)、处理过程(P)、输出(O)思想。图9-1层次化结构模块图层次化结构模块图是从结构化设计的角度提出的一种工具。汽车配件公司业企业业务管理系统库存管理财务管理采购管理销售管理会计账目管理会计报表管理订货管理客户管理采购配件管理供应商管理库存量管理库存查询管理务管理信息系统的模块化分为若干子系统,如销售管理子系统、采购管理子系统等,它们之间是平级关系,并且,相互之间也不交叉。同时,一个模块还下分了子模块,如销售管理子系统下面包含了客户管理和订货管理两个子模块。这样,从整体上来划分,形成从全局来进行管理的格局。图9-2层次化订货管理模块结构图图10-1订单输入IPO图订单输入IPO图表示了订单输入模块,讲述了如何输入客户订单,检查其正确性,核对建立新的账号等功能。输入部分I处理描述P输出部分O1.利用权限打开数据库2.输入定货单的顾客信息:名称、地址、电话、开户行、账号3.输入定货单的各类信息:配件名称、规格、编号1.核对用户账号和新建用账号2.核查定单信息3.处理过程出错信息定单不合格新建用户合格定单处理老用户合格定单处理1.将合格标志送回上一级调用模式2.将核对的记录记入文件3.修改顾客记录4.将合格的定单信息以标准格式输出模块名称:定单输入系统使用单位:销售部订货管理A.1订单输入A.2.1订单处理A.2.2开发货单A.2.3模块名称:定单处理系统使用单位:销售部和采购部输入部分I处理描述P输出部分O1.利用权限打开数据库2.上组模块送入的合格的定单1.将定单的配件信息与配件当前存量核对2.处理过程1.将合格标志送回上一级调用模式2.将核对的记录记入文件图10-2订单处理IPO图订单处理IPO图表示了订单处理模块,讲述了如何核对处理订单,对库存量和订单进行比较处理等功能。图10-3库存查询IPO图库存查询IPO图表示了库存查询管理模块,讲述了如何核对配件信息和原有配件库存量,核查近期销售记录情况以及对出错信息的处理。模块名称:库存量查询系统使用单位:销售部和经理输入部分I处理描述P输出部分O1.利用权限打开数据库2.输入查询的配件编号、规格、名称等信息3.读取近期销售记录4.读取原有配件库存量1.核对配件信息和原有配件库存量2.核查近期销售记录情况3.处理过程出错信息当前零库存量配件处理当前库存量详细处理1.将合格标志送回上一级调用模式2.将核对的记录记入文件3.输出销售库存的当前查询结果文件图9-3层次化配件采购管理模块结构图图10-4暂存订单处理IPO图暂存订单处理IPO图表示了暂存订单管理模块,讲述了如何核查暂存订单配件汇总信息,核对暂存配件和相应的供应商的列表等处理过程。暂存订单输入C.2.1C.2配件采购管理C.2.2暂存订单处理C.2.3配件入库模块名称:暂存订单处理系统使用单位:采购部输入部分I处理描述P输出部分O1.利用权限打开数据库2.输入暂存订货单配件信息:编号、规格、名称、暂缺数量等3.读取供应商列表信息1.核查暂存订货单配件汇总信息2.核对暂存配件和相应的供应商列表3.处理过程1.将合格标志送回上一级调用模式2.将核对的记录记入文件3.修改供应商列表信息4.输出以供应商分类的采购订货单出错信息按配件汇总处理按供应商汇总处理模块名称:配件入库处理系统使用单位:采购部输入部分I处理描述P输出部分O1.利用权限打开数据库1.核对采购订货单和发货单信息1.将合格标志送回上一级调用模式图10-5配件入库处理IPO图配件入库处理IPO图表示了配件管理模块,讲述了如何核对采购订货单合法货单信息,核对发货配件质量信息和标准配件质量信息等功能。第五章系统设计总结第一节项目实施中各个工作流程及时间分布1.项目开发的编写1天2.业务流程图设计2天3.数据流程图设计1天4.E-R图设计1天5.U/C矩阵设计2天6.HIPO图设计2天7.文档修改、定稿1天第二节本人系统设计特点1.优点:本系统具有较强的直观性,设计完整,能较好的体现系统的设计构思;缺点:设计的有些方面有点简单,有很多地方还需进一步分析改进。目录前言······································································································1第一部分项目管理与计划·········································································1实验1制定项目计划··········································································1实验2项目可行性分析·······································································1第二部分系统分析··················································································1实验3项目需求收集··········································································1实验4用例建模················································································1实验5通过用例获取概念数据模型························································1实验6将概念数据模型转换为对象关系模型············································1实验7分析类图建模(序列图、交互图、状态图、活动图)·······················1实验8确定设计方案(*)···································································1第三部分系统设计··················································································1实验9物理数据库设计·······································································1实验10确定